Austral development near Western Sydney Airport has transformed Liverpool into a commuter nightmare

One of Australia’s fastest-growing suburbs is caught in a development dilemma where the surging construction of homes is swamping local roads.
Key points:
- Liverpool is just 13 kilometres away from the under-construction Western Sydney Airport
- Austral is not on a train line and the closest station is 4km away
- A planned corridor upgrade isn’t expected for years
The problem at Austral, 42 kilometres south-west of Sydney, has become so dire that some drivers are swerving onto the wrong side of the road to avoid bottlenecks, which locals say add 30 minutes to a peak-hour commute.
About 30,000 homes are being built in the suburb, with the finishing touches being put on roughly 100 each week.
